Yesteryear actress Amala Akkineni is a great animal lover. At this Covid times, she finds time to speak up for animals. Pet animals won’t contract Covid 19 disease. Several organisations including the Animal Welfare Board of India has confirmed this.

Amala, who heads the NGO ‘Blue Cross of Hyderabad,’ is an anima; activist as well as social worker. She and Blue Cross have jointly done several activities for giving shelter to animals.
